IEC 60332-2-2 specifies the procedure for testing resistance to vertical flame propagation for a single small vertical electrically insulated conductor or cable or optical cable under fire conditions.

IEC EN 60332-2-2 Tests on Electrical and Fiber Optic Cables under Fire Conditions - Part 2-2: Vertical Flame Propagation Testing for a Single Small Insulated Wire or Cable

The apparatus is given in IEC EN 60332-2-1. This standard gives the procedure for testing small fiber optic cables or a small insulated conductor or cable where the method specified in IEC EN 60332-1-2 is not suitable, because some small fiber optic cables may break or small conductors, IEC EN 60332- It may melt during the application of 1-2.

The recommended application range is for testing small single insulated conductors or cables with a cross section of less than 0,5 mm². Special installation precautions must also be taken wherever the risk of spread is high, for example in long vertical cable bundles, as the use of insulated conductors or cables that retard flame propagation and comply with the recommended requirements of this standard are not alone sufficient to prevent the spread of fire under all installation conditions.

Because the cable sample complies with the performance requirements recommended in this standard, it cannot be assumed that a cable bundle will behave similarly. The specimen should be firmly fixed to the two horizontal supports with wires of the appropriate size so that the distance between the bottom of the upper support and the top of the lower support is (550 ± 5) mm. In addition, the sample should be placed with the lower end approximately 50 mm from the base of the screen.

If the original surface of the sample is not damaged after wiping, attention should be paid to drying; Softened or deformed parts of non-metallic materials should also be disregarded. The distance between the lower edge of the upper support and the upper and lower limits of the carbon zone is measured to the nearest millimetre.
